🥘 Ingredients

6 items
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• 1 tablespoon granulated sugar
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 cup unsalted butter, cold
  • 0.75 cup whole milk, cold

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

2

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, sugar, and salt.

3

Cut the cold unsalted butter into small cubes, then add it to the dry ingredients. Use a pastry cutter or your fingertips to combine until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.

4

Make a well in the center of the bowl and pour in the cold milk. Gently stir with a wooden spoon or spatula until the dough just comes together. Be careful not to overmix.

5

Transfer the dough to a lightly floured surface. Pat it out into a 1-inch thick rectangle. Fold the dough over onto itself 2–3 times to create flaky layers, then gently pat it out again to 1-inch thickness.

6

Using a 2.5-inch biscuit cutter or the rim of a glass, cut out biscuits. Press straight down without twisting to help the biscuits rise evenly. Re-roll the scraps as needed to cut additional biscuits.

7

Place the biscuits on the prepared baking sheet, ensuring they are slightly touching for soft sides or spaced apart for crispy edges.

8

Bake in the preheated oven for 10–12 minutes, or until the tops are golden brown.

9

Remove the biscuits from the oven and let them cool slightly before serving. Enjoy warm with butter, jam, or your favorite toppings.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(71.3g)
Calories
241
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 13.0 g 17%
Saturated Fat 8.1 g 41%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 35 mg 12%
Sodium 334 mg 15%
Total Carbohydrate 26.7 g 10%
Dietary Fiber 0.9 g 3%
Total Sugars 2.8 g
Protein 4.1 g 8%
Vitamin D 0.3 mcg 1%
Calcium 33 mg 3%
Iron 1.1 mg 6%
Potassium 60 mg 1%
